Lawn Mower Belt worn
1. Removed all the cawling covering the belt.
2. Removed the left front tire.
3. Losen the pulleys around the main shaft and the rear pulley.
4. Removed the worn belt.
5. Installed the new belt.
6. Reassemble in reverse order.

Belt would not move
A real pain to remove plastic shields under mower
Belt pulleys very difficult to get around and place new belt on
One bolt broke off in frame
Took 3 hours, not an easy repair primarily due to AWD pulleys. FWD much easier
Significant amount of hatd packed grass in pulleys etc
